
Germany's best-selling iPhone navigation app, with more than 150,000 sold, uses free maps from OpenStreetMap.
The app enables motorists and pedestrians to highlight issues and submit map changes or corrections, giving all users access to up-to-date maps with no update fee.
skobbler features include turn-by-turn GPS navigation, visual and voice-guided navigation, day and night display modes, 2.5D bird's eye view graphics, automatic continuation of navigation after incoming calls, pedestrian mode, ‘take me home' function, and bookmarks for favourite destinations.
